  • Description 4-Methy 1-5-thiazoleethanol has the characteristic disagreeable odor of thiazole compounds. It is somewhat pleasant and nut-like on extreme dilution. It may be prepared by reduction of ethyl- 4-methylthiazole-5-acetate using LiAlH4; by condensation of thioformamide with bromoacetopropanol or with y,y-dichloro-y,ydiacetodipropyl ether.
  • Uses 4-Methyl-5-thiazoleethanol has been used in the synthesis of novel thiazolium halogenide ionic liquids.
